Having a sand and water table in my classroom will give my preschool students an opportunity to learn through hands-on experiences. With a sand and water table I can support and enhance what my students' are learning in their curriculum.
Wouldn't it be fantastic to have flour, mixing bowls and wooden spoons in the sand and a water table when reading "The Little Red Hen?"
Students learn in a variety ways. A sand and water table has the potential to create tactile learning experiences for my students who learn by doing. In the words of the Little Red Hen, "Who will donate to have a sand and water table in my classroom?"
